What does a remote seismic data processing geophysicist do?

A Remote Seismic Data Processing Geophysicist specializes in analyzing seismic data, often from a remote location, to help interpret subsurface geological structures. They use advanced software and algorithms to process raw seismic signals collected during surveys, improving the quality and clarity of the data. Their work is crucial in industries such as oil and gas exploration, environmental studies, and earthquake research. By working remotely, they leverage digital tools to collaborate with teams and deliver results without being on-site.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ote seismic data processing geophysicist?

To thrive as a Remote Seismic Data Processing Geophysicist, you need a strong background in geophysics, seismic interpretation, and quantitative analysis, usually supported by a relevant degree such as geophysics, geology, or physics. Proficiency with seismic processing software (e.g., ProMAX, Petrel, or SeisSpace), programming languages (such as Python or MATLAB), and experience with remote collaboration tools are typically required.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help professionals excel in interpreting complex datasets and reporting findings to multidisciplinary teams. These skills ensure accurate seismic data analysis, efficient remote collaboration, and effective contribution to exploration or monitoring projects.

What are some common challenges faced by remote seismic data processing geophysicists, and how can they be managed?

Remote Seismic Data Processing Geophysicists often encounter challenges such as managing large data sets, ensuring data quality, and troubleshooting processing software issues without on-site support. Effective communication with field teams and clients is crucial to clarify data requirements and resolve discrepancies quickly. Staying updated with the latest processing techniques and maintaining strong organizational skills help manage project deadlines and deliver accurate results. Collaboration tools and regular virtual meetings are commonly used to facilitate teamwork and overcome the limitations of remote work.
